一、语音合成技术的核心能力演进
语音合成(Text-to-Speech)作为人机交互的关键技术,其发展已从基础语音生成迈向高拟真、个性化、场景化的新阶段。当前主流技术方案通过深度学习模型实现三大核心突破:
-
超自然语音表现力
传统TTS系统生成的语音机械感强,难以传递情感与语境。新一代模型通过引入情感编码器与韵律预测模块,可基于文本语义自动调整语调、停顿、重音等参数。例如,在生成对话类语音时,系统能识别问句、感叹句等句式特征,动态调整音高曲线;针对小说朗读场景,可通过分析文本情感标签(如愤怒、喜悦)生成对应的情绪化语音。部分技术方案还支持方言口音模拟,通过迁移学习将标准发音模型适配至特定地域口音。 -
声纹克隆技术突破
声纹克隆是当前TTS领域的热点方向,其核心挑战在于用极少量数据构建高保真声学模型。主流技术采用两阶段训练策略:- 特征提取阶段:通过自编码器网络从3-5秒音频中提取说话人身份特征(如基频、共振峰分布);
- 微调阶段:将提取的特征嵌入至预训练语音合成模型,联合文本与声学特征进行端到端优化。
该技术已实现97%以上的声纹相似度,在客服机器人、有声读物等场景中显著降低录音成本。
-
多语言混合建模能力
全球化应用需求推动TTS系统向多语言支持演进。技术实现上存在两种路径:- 独立模型架构:为每种语言训练专用声学模型,共享文本编码器以降低计算开销;
- 统一多语言模型:通过语言ID嵌入与跨语言注意力机制,实现单一模型支持10+种语言合成。
后者在跨语言发音一致性上表现更优,尤其适合跨境电商、国际会议等场景。
二、实时语音合成的技术挑战与解决方案
实时对话场景对TTS系统提出严苛要求:端到端延迟需控制在200ms以内,同时保证语音质量与流畅度。实现这一目标需攻克三大技术难点:
-
流式生成架构优化
传统TTS采用全序列生成模式,需等待完整文本输入后才启动音频渲染,导致首字延迟较高。流式方案通过以下改进实现低延迟:- 增量式文本处理:将输入文本切分为短语单元,每接收一个单元即触发局部语音生成;
- 动态缓冲区控制:维护固定长度的音频缓冲区,通过自适应采样率调整平衡延迟与卡顿率;
- 模型轻量化设计:采用知识蒸馏技术将大模型压缩至参数量<50M,配合量化推理实现移动端实时运行。
-
抗噪声与鲁棒性增强
真实场景中存在背景噪音、口音偏差等问题,需通过数据增强与模型优化提升鲁棒性:- 数据层面:构建包含200+种噪声类型的训练集,覆盖机场、车站等典型场景;
- 模型层面:引入对抗训练机制,使合成语音对不同信噪比条件具有不变性;
- 后处理层面:部署传统降噪算法(如WebRTC NS)与深度学习去噪模型的混合方案。
-
资源受限环境适配
在嵌入式设备或边缘计算节点部署TTS系统时,需解决计算资源与内存限制问题。技术方案包括:- 模型剪枝:移除神经网络中冗余连接,在保持98%准确率的前提下减少30%计算量;
- 量化压缩:将FP32权重转换为INT8格式,模型体积缩小75%且推理速度提升2倍;
- 硬件加速:利用NPU/DSP专用芯片优化矩阵运算,实现100ms内生成1秒音频。
三、技术选型与落地实践指南
开发者在选择TTS技术方案时,需综合评估以下维度:
-
场景适配性
- 智能客服:优先选择支持情感表达与多轮对话上下文建模的方案;
- 有声内容生产:关注声纹克隆精度与多语言支持能力;
- 车载系统:需重点考察流式生成延迟与抗噪声性能。
-
开发效率与成本
- 云服务方案:提供开箱即用的API调用,适合快速验证与轻量级应用;
- 私有化部署:需评估模型训练成本与硬件投入,适合数据敏感型业务;
- 开源框架:如某开源语音合成工具包,可自由定制模型结构但需较强技术能力。
-
典型实现代码示例
以下为基于某深度学习框架的流式TTS推理伪代码:class StreamingTTS:def __init__(self, model_path):self.model = load_pretrained_model(model_path) # 加载量化模型self.buffer = deque(maxlen=1024) # 音频缓冲区def process_chunk(self, text_chunk):# 增量式文本处理acoustic_features = self.model.encode(text_chunk)# 流式声学特征生成for feature in acoustic_features.split(200ms):audio_chunk = vocoder(feature) # 神经网络声码器self.buffer.extend(audio_chunk)if len(self.buffer) >= 48000: # 1秒音频yield self.buffer.popleft()
四、未来发展趋势展望
随着大模型技术的渗透,TTS领域将呈现三大趋势:
- 个性化与可控性增强:通过少样本学习实现说话人风格迁移,支持语速、音高等参数的实时调整;
- 多模态融合:与唇形同步、手势生成等技术结合,构建更自然的虚拟数字人;
- 边缘智能深化:在终端设备上实现全流程语音合成,摆脱对云服务的依赖。
当前,国内多家技术团队已在上述方向取得突破,其研发成果正通过云服务、SDK等形式赋能千行百业。开发者可根据业务需求,选择具备技术前瞻性与工程落地能力的解决方案,加速AI语音应用的创新实践。